Walk around Kärsön. There are buses to Ekerö and The Drottningholm Royal Castle. Perhaps you want to see where the Swedish King and family lives and it's there in Drottningholm. If you want to have a nice walk in nature you could press the red button the bus stop before Drottningholm. That's Kärsön and it's a beautiful and fresh walk, around an island with a varying landscape. Kärsön is a nature reserve and enough for a daily walk around. There's a nice café near the entrance to Kärsön and another just before the walking track begin.
Varying landscape. To get to the entrance of the walkin track one goes or drives passes Brostugan on the left hand. Turns right to the road that leads to an Activity Center and Kärsögårdens coffee hous on the left hand. On the oppsite side there's a parking place and further down the road at the end, begins the walking track around Kärsön. I think clockwise is the best way to walk around and the track is marked with red color. You come to an meadow after about 100 meters where the track goes in differnt directions. We go to the left where there's a post standing marked with red at the top. On the way you'll find many nice spots made for a pause. If it's not to dry in the ground one can make a fire and grill some sausages. The landscape is varying with all kind of forest and goes through open landscape as well. One walks with the lake Mälaren on the left hand side the entire track around Kärsön. So one can't really get lost and on the other side of the island one sees Drottningholm from a different angle. The King's boat use to be at the bridge if he's at home. The tour round Kärsön is apr. 5 km.

Jan "IT-gubben" Wåland var en av förfäderna och en legend i geocaching Sverige. Mellan åren 2001 och 2010 placerade han ut 134 gömmor runtom i Sverige, platser som han hade besökt – och som han vill att flera skulle upptäcka.
Tyvärr lämnade Jan oss i 2020. Under hösten samma år kontaktades familjen om att adoptera de sjuttiotal aktiva IT-gubben cachar, för att hålla dessa i liv och för framtida generationer. I april 2021 startades projektet Rädda IT-gubbens geoskatt! – med målsättning att finna lokala geocachare som vill adoptera och förvalta en eller flera av IT-gubbens gömmor nära sig.
